Morrison's hat trick boosts Norwich over Burford, 6-3

Burford Community Centre    Sat, Nov 22, 2014

Zack Morrison netted a hat trick to lead the Norwich Merchants over the Burford Bulldogs, 6-3.

Morrison got on the scoresheet 1:24 into the first period. He then added goals at 4:50 into the first and at 3:06 into the second.

Norwich stifled Burford's power play, and did not give up a single goal while down a man. The Bulldogs were unable to stop the Merchants from sending pucks towards the net, and Norwich eventually piled up 43 shots on goal. The Merchants bested their season scoring average. This season, Norwich averages 3.2 goals per contest.

Norwich additionally got points from Kurtis Lavis, who also had one goal and one assist and Braeden Shand, who also racked up one goal and one assist. Norwich also got a goal from Mitchell Berzins as well. More assists for Norwich came via Jesse Szabo, who had two and Ryan Stephenson and Troy Lamoure, who contributed one each.

Burford forced Merchants' goalies to work between the pipes, totaling 38 shots and forcing 35 saves. Justin Pacheco made 14 stops and Patrick Maziarz made 21. The Bulldogs found themselves short handed often, totaling 34 penalty minutes and allowing nine power plays.

Burford was helped by Adam Harris, who registered two goals. Harris scored the first of his two goals at 26 seconds into the second period to make the score 4-1 Norwich. Kyle Walker provided the assist. Harris' next tally made the score 5-3 Norwich with 15:02 left in the third period. Chris Grand picked up the assist. Jesse Brooks also scored for Burford. Other players who recorded assists for Burford were Jack Battaglia and Mitch Randell, who each chipped in one.

The Merchants incurred 22 minutes in penalty time with six minors. For Norwich, Lavis and Morrison were ejected from the contest. Michael Black made 37 saves for the Bulldogs on 43 shots. Burford registered zero goals on four power play opportunities. Team's Anthony Van Looyen and Broidy Rondelet were slapped with misconducts and ejected from the game.
